About Bloody Time
It may have taken them more than two decades, but My Bloody Valentine frontman Kevin Shields says the band is finally just about finished with the follow-up to 1991's 'Loveless' -- and that it'll be out before the end of the year.

My Bloody Valentine Reissuing Back Catalog
Shoegaze legends My Bloody Valentine have announced plans to reissue their entire back catalog on May 8, including remastered editions of the Irish quartet's watershed 'Isn't Anything' and 'Loveless' albums, plus a two-disc set that will include EP releases, outtakes, unreleased tracks and other rarities.
